Output ad24149d531d4acc9d3d653e7dd0a801039f2feb2f7c55a430b224a94da10793:3

value
15929738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62607add581e50cd89b3ffb2c7b317329e782722 OP_EQUAL
address
3AfBitPjETYkG2bnFx6WECi5TWWmpB6bNX
transaction
ad24149d531d4acc9d3d653e7dd0a801039f2feb2f7c55a430b224a94da10793
confirmations
267980
spent
true